Alternate Slipper Option - 04.21.2008, 08:45 PM

Heads up and thoughts...

I run a robinson racing slipper with a 66T plastic and 65T steel spur... Somthing BrianG got me thinging it was mentioned that the MGT spur is Mod 1 and fits an emaxx.

Well low and behold - RR do a slipper for the MGT with a 54T spur. An email later and for 18.5 I can have a 54T spur to go on my existing EMAX RR slipper...

Just re-reconfirming it is Mod 1 pitch (99.9999% sure it is as 54T is 56mm diam) but this looks like a very easy way to convert to Mod1 and provide a better range of gearing options...
